Highlights
Are people in LaGrange older or younger than people in Ipswich?
- The Median Age in LaGrange is 1.4 years younger than in Ipswich.

Are housing costs cheaper in LaGrange or Ipswich?
- LaGrange housing costs are 43.5% more expensive than Ipswich hous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, LaGrange or Ipswich?
- The average commute for residents of LaGrange is 3.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Ipswich.

Things to do in Ipswich?
Ipswich, SD is a small town with a population of about 1,100 people. The town is surrounded by beautiful rolling hills and grasslands and has a very peaceful atmosphere. Residents enjoy the close-knit community and access to recreation activities such as hunting, fishing, camping, and golfing. There are several local businesses in the downtown area providing employment opportunities as well as various places to shop and dine. Ipswich also offers a variety of activities for families such as swimming lessons at an outdoor pool, summer festivals and events, art classes in the park, a library with plenty of books to borrow, and movies on Friday nights during the summertime. With its friendly people and vibrant small-town atmosphere, Ipswich is an ideal place to call home.

Things to do in LaGrange?
LaGrange, GA is a historic city located in the heart of West Georgia. The city is known for its quaint downtown district, architectural beauty, and recreational opportunities provided by its numerous parks and lakes. LaGrange offers a unique blend of small-town charm and big-city amenities that make it an ideal place to visit or call home!
